云主机测评网云主机测评网云主机测评网

云主机测评网
www.yunzhuji.net

如何在MySQL中更改数据库权限并设置账号密码?

要更改MySQL数据库的权限设置密码或设置数据库账号密码,可以使用以下方法:,,1. 使用ALTER USER命令更改现有用户的密码:,“sql,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';,FLUSH PRIVILEGES;,`,将username替换为要更改密码的用户名,将new_password替换为新密码。,,2. 创建新用户并设置密码:,`sql,CREATE USER 'new_username'@'localhost' IDENTIFIED BY 'new_password';,GRANT ALL PRIVILEGES ON database_name.* TO 'new_username'@'localhost';,FLUSH PRIVILEGES;,`,将new_username替换为新用户的用户名,将new_password替换为新密码,将database_name`替换为要授权的数据库名称。,,注意:在执行这些SQL语句之前,确保您具有足够的权限来修改用户和数据库权限。

在MySQL中,更改数据库权限设置密码和设置数据库账号密码可以通过以下步骤完成:

1. 登录到MySQL服务器

你需要使用管理员账户登录到MySQL服务器,打开命令行或终端,并输入以下命令:

mysql u root p

然后输入你的root账户密码。

2. 创建新用户(可选)

如果你需要为特定数据库创建一个新用户,可以使用以下SQL命令:

C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';

newuser替换为你想要的用户名,将password替换为你选择的密码。

3. 授权用户访问特定数据库

如果你想让用户能够访问特定的数据库,你可以使用以下SQL命令:

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';

database_name替换为你想要授权的数据库名称,将username替换为之前创建的用户名。

4. 刷新权限

执行以下命令以使更改生效:

FLUSH PRIVILEGES;

5. 退出MySQL

使用以下命令退出MySQL:

EXIT;

示例代码块

以下是一个完整的示例,展示了如何创建一个新用户并为其分配权限:

 登录到MySQL服务器
mysql u root p
 创建新用户
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
 授权用户访问特定数据库
GRANT ALL PRIVILEGES ON database_name.* TO 'newuser'@'localhost';
 刷新权限
FLUSH PRIVILEGES;
 退出MySQL
EXIT;

请确保将newuserpassworddatabase_name替换为实际的值。

打赏
版权声明:主机测评不销售、不代购、不提供任何支持,仅分享信息/测评(有时效性),自行辨别,请遵纪守法文明上网。
文章名称:《如何在MySQL中更改数据库权限并设置账号密码?》
文章链接:https://www.yunzhuji.net/xunizhuji/263741.html

评论

  • 验证码